In the world of automotive engineering, the term wheel steering refers to the mechanism that allows a driver to control the direction of a vehicle by turning the steering wheel. This essential function plays a crucial role in ensuring safety and maneuverability on the road. Understanding how wheel steering works can enhance our appreciation of vehicle dynamics and improve our driving skills.The basic principle behind wheel steering involves the connection between the steering wheel and the wheels of the vehicle. When a driver turns the steering wheel, it activates a series of components, including the steering column, rack and pinion, and ultimately the tie rods that connect to the wheels. This system translates the rotational movement of the steering wheel into lateral movement of the wheels, allowing the vehicle to change direction.There are various types of wheel steering systems, each with its advantages and disadvantages. The most common type is the conventional mechanical steering system, which relies on physical linkages to transmit the driver's input to the wheels. However, modern vehicles often employ power steering systems, which use hydraulic or electric actuators to assist the driver in turning the wheel, making it easier to maneuver the vehicle, especially at low speeds.One of the key benefits of effective wheel steering is improved vehicle stability. A well-designed steering system can provide precise feedback to the driver, allowing for better control during high-speed maneuvers or sudden turns. Additionally, advancements in technology have led to the development of features such as adaptive steering, which adjusts the steering ratio based on speed and driving conditions, further enhancing the driving experience.Safety is another critical aspect of wheel steering. The ability to steer accurately can prevent accidents and collisions, making it imperative for drivers to understand their vehicle's steering system. Regular maintenance of the steering components, such as checking for wear and tear, can ensure that the wheel steering system functions optimally.Moreover, the concept of wheel steering extends beyond traditional vehicles. In motorsports, for example, drivers rely heavily on their steering capabilities to navigate complex tracks at high speeds. The precision required in these situations emphasizes the importance of mastering wheel steering techniques, as even the slightest miscalculation can lead to catastrophic results.In conclusion, wheel steering is a fundamental aspect of vehicle operation that directly impacts safety, performance, and overall driving enjoyment. By understanding the mechanics behind wheel steering, drivers can become more adept at handling their vehicles, leading to a safer and more enjoyable driving experience. Whether you are a casual driver or a motorsport enthusiast, appreciating the intricacies of wheel steering can enhance your relationship with your vehicle and improve your skills on the road.
